{"passport":{"unfragile":{"@version":"1.0","version":"2026-05","artifact":{"id":"smithery_fourcolors-omi-mcp","slug":"fourcolors-omi-mcp","name":"Omi MCP Server","type":"mcp","url":"https://github.com/fourcolors/omi-mcp","page_url":"https://unfragile.ai/fourcolors-omi-mcp","categories":["mcp-servers"],"tags":["mcp","model-context-protocol","smithery:fourcolors/omi-mcp"],"pricing":{"model":"open_source","free":true,"starting_price":null},"status":"active","verified":false},"capabilities":[{"id":"smithery_fourcolors-omi-mcp__cap_0","uri":"capability://data.processing.analysis.seamless.user.data.retrieval","name":"seamless user data retrieval","description":"This capability allows for efficient retrieval of user data from the Omi API using a RESTful approach, leveraging asynchronous calls to minimize latency. It employs caching strategies to enhance performance, ensuring that frequently accessed data is quickly available without repeated API calls. This design choice enables applications to maintain responsiveness while interacting with user data.","intents":["How can I quickly fetch user conversation history?","What is the best way to retrieve user preferences for personalized experiences?","How do I access user data for analytics purposes?"],"best_for":["developers building conversational applications that require quick access to user data"],"limitations":["Limited to JSON format responses from the Omi API","Rate limits imposed by the Omi API may affect retrieval speed"],"requires":["Node.js 14+","Omi API key"],"input_types":["API requests"],"output_types":["structured data (JSON)"],"categories":["data-processing-analysis","api integration"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"smithery_fourcolors-omi-mcp__cap_1","uri":"capability://data.processing.analysis.user.data.creation.and.manipulation","name":"user data creation and manipulation","description":"This capability enables the creation and modification of user data through a structured API interface, allowing developers to send well-defined payloads to the Omi API. It supports batch operations for efficiency, enabling multiple user data entries to be created or updated in a single request, thus optimizing network usage and reducing overhead.","intents":["How can I create new user profiles in bulk?","What is the best way to update user data attributes?","How do I manage user data effectively in my application?"],"best_for":["developers needing to manage large sets of user data efficiently"],"limitations":["Batch operations are limited to 100 entries per request","No support for complex data types beyond basic JSON structures"],"requires":["Node.js 14+","Omi API key"],"input_types":["structured data (JSON)"],"output_types":["structured data (JSON)"],"categories":["data-processing-analysis","api integration"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"smithery_fourcolors-omi-mcp__cap_2","uri":"capability://memory.knowledge.conversation.management","name":"conversation management","description":"This capability provides tools for managing ongoing conversations by interfacing with the Omi API to track conversation states and user interactions. It uses a state machine pattern to maintain context across multiple exchanges, ensuring that applications can provide coherent and contextually aware responses based on previous interactions.","intents":["How can I maintain context in user conversations?","What is the best way to track conversation history?","How do I implement multi-turn conversations in my app?"],"best_for":["developers creating chatbots or conversational agents that require context management"],"limitations":["Limited to a single conversation context per user session","State management requires careful handling to avoid context loss"],"requires":["Node.js 14+","Omi API key"],"input_types":["text","structured data"],"output_types":["text","structured data"],"categories":["memory-knowledge","conversational ai"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"smithery_fourcolors-omi-mcp__cap_3","uri":"capability://memory.knowledge.memory.manipulation","name":"memory manipulation","description":"This capability allows applications to manipulate memory states associated with users, enabling the storage and retrieval of contextual information that can enhance user interactions. It uses a key-value store approach to manage memory efficiently, allowing for quick access and updates to user-specific data points.","intents":["How can I store user preferences for future interactions?","What is the best way to retrieve stored memories for personalized responses?","How do I update user memory effectively?"],"best_for":["developers looking to implement personalized experiences based on user memory"],"limitations":["Memory storage is ephemeral and may not persist across sessions without external storage solutions","Limited to basic key-value pairs"],"requires":["Node.js 14+","Omi API key"],"input_types":["structured data (JSON)"],"output_types":["structured data (JSON)"],"categories":["memory-knowledge","personalization"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"smithery_fourcolors-omi-mcp__cap_4","uri":"capability://tool.use.integration.api.orchestration.for.multi.provider.support","name":"api orchestration for multi-provider support","description":"This capability enables the orchestration of API calls to multiple providers through a unified interface, allowing developers to seamlessly integrate various services into their applications. It employs a middleware layer that abstracts the complexities of different API protocols, enabling consistent interaction patterns regardless of the underlying service.","intents":["How can I integrate multiple APIs into my application easily?","What is the best way to manage API interactions from different providers?","How do I ensure consistent data handling across various APIs?"],"best_for":["developers needing to connect disparate services into a cohesive application"],"limitations":["May introduce additional latency due to orchestration overhead","Requires careful management of API keys and credentials for each service"],"requires":["Node.js 14+","Omi API key"],"input_types":["API requests"],"output_types":["structured data (JSON)"],"categories":["tool-use-integration","api management"],"confidence":0.5,"matches":0,"success_rate":0}],"trust":{"score":29,"verified":false,"data_access_risk":"moderate","permissions":["Node.js 14+","Omi API key"],"failure_modes":["Limited to JSON format responses from the Omi API","Rate limits imposed by the Omi API may affect retrieval speed","Batch operations are limited to 100 entries per request","No support for complex data types beyond basic JSON structures","Limited to a single conversation context per user session","State management requires careful handling to avoid context loss","Memory storage is ephemeral and may not persist across sessions without external storage solutions","Limited to basic key-value pairs","May introduce additional latency due to orchestration overhead","Requires careful management of API keys and credentials for each service","builder identity is not verified yet","no observed match outcomes yet"],"rank_breakdown":{"adoption":0.05,"quality":0.35,"ecosystem":0.48999999999999994,"match_graph":0.25,"freshness":0.52,"weights":{"adoption":0.25,"quality":0.25,"ecosystem":0.15,"match_graph":0.23,"freshness":0.12}},"observed_outcomes":{"matches":0,"success_rate":0,"avg_confidence":0,"top_intents":[],"last_matched_at":null},"maintenance":{"status":"active","updated_at":"2026-05-24T12:16:26.346Z","last_scraped_at":"2026-05-03T15:19:00.490Z","last_commit":null},"community":{"stars":null,"forks":null,"weekly_downloads":null,"model_downloads":null,"model_likes":null}},"distribution":{"claim_url":"https://unfragile.ai/submit?claim=fourcolors-omi-mcp","compare_url":"https://unfragile.ai/compare?artifact=fourcolors-omi-mcp"}},"signature":"W6ewYuxn3hACJwviGQIPS6UyZ7YqcPs0jIQ3f8QOr70kJL5F32GoYQ65PQt8g4bsZ/pyLCqTvuRWHFS4oFTTDQ==","signedAt":"2026-06-20T04:00:00.615Z","signedBy":"unfragile.ai","version":1},"_links":{"self":"https://unfragile.ai/api/v1/passport/fourcolors-omi-mcp","artifact":"https://unfragile.ai/fourcolors-omi-mcp","verify":"https://unfragile.ai/api/v1/verify?slug=fourcolors-omi-mcp","publicKey":"https://unfragile.ai/api/v1/trust-passport-public-key","spec":"https://unfragile.ai/trust","schema":"https://unfragile.ai/schema.json","docs":"https://unfragile.ai/docs"}}